A poll by the Democratic firm PPP finds a 7-point shift toward Mitt Romney in Wisconsin since Romney added Paul Ryan to the ticket. In July, Obama led Romney 50 percent to 44 percent in PPP's poll, but PPP now finds that Romney leads Obama 48 percent to 47 percent (the exact same results of an August 15 Rasmussen poll). While PPP finds that Democratic voters remain just as committed to Obama, there's been a 10-point shift among both independents and Republicans toward Romney:
